Gloves | 11,761 Administrator · Posted May 15, 2021 Author Share Posted May 15, 2021 50 minutes ago, JVOSS said: sorry and why would u do this? do you give the keys to your car someone? Allowing people to use their social media (or other) accounts like this is common practice. It provides an easy way for people people to log in to the site if they choose to do so in this way; it's one less account that you have to worry about, as you simply need to know your social media account login in order to access this site. Data has shown that users tend to be dissuaded from joining a site without this feature as they don't want to have to fill out yet another registration form, remember another username/password (not everyone uses a password manager), or in the case of forgetting their login info, go through the recovery process. If you have some concern with you feature you're welcome to let me know and I will be happy to further explain. It's entirely opt-in, too. You can simply choose to ignore the feature if you don't want to use it. The option is merely there for those who want it. 1 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
